Transaction d4136bf624f7e1f834576a3e12d2495a19c83b123b2d3c016265714b7d25dce9

33 Input
1 Outputs
  • d4136bf624f7e1f834576a3e12d2495a19c83b123b2d3c016265714b7d25dce9:0
  • value  34459476
    address  12xaKY1D9e3ZQ2oHpcro8w7E5qu7asSb3Q